Output 73b3a61feee8bad317ba425b99fc4f920de73e268f2f52bfb734a36d9f1331d8:3

value
19629580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a270b3be51b1c849053f069148070def20ca983f OP_EQUAL
address
MNi4iBpxuP8Wg5aJHF7dCbHdCAo3kLUop7
transaction
73b3a61feee8bad317ba425b99fc4f920de73e268f2f52bfb734a36d9f1331d8
spent
true